Police encounters can be intimidating and stressful. It's crucial to know your rights when interacting with law enforcement. Always remember that you have the right to remain silent, as anything you say can be used against you. Recording these encounters can help ensure accountability. Using tools like smartphones to document interactions can provide important evidence. However, it’s important to follow local laws regarding recording in public. Be mindful of your surroundings and assess the situation to remain safe. This guidance is vital in navigating police encounters, whether you are a bystander or directly involved.
